You can Buy Second Hand Bikes in Chennai through online websites such as Quikr, OLX, Zigwheel etc. or opt for an offline method. The online portals are quite trustworthy and hence, have gained a lot of popularity. These portals sell verified bikes and one does not have to go around in the market looking for a suitable bike as it is all a click away. On the other hand, offline method is the traditional one in which the dealer acts as the mediator. Even though dealers can fetch you good and suitable deals, sticking to one dealer is not advised. If you are a potential buyer, you must go around in the market to research and tally the prices of various dealers. Also, sometimes these shops and dealers, in order to fill their own pockets conspire with the seller and sell of a bike at a much higher price. They do this by making the outer body of the bike look new and concealing some of the technical or mechanical faults in the bike which the buyer should definitely be aware of.

Also, sometimes the sellers try and forge the ownership documents of the bike which leads to legal issues in the future. As a responsible buyer, one should get the documents of ownership as well as registration verifies from the respective office so as to prevent yourself from falling prey to such fraudulent activities.
